The Shoreacres City Council on Monday, after lengthy discussion, voted unanimously to table an ordinance regarding the regulation of off-street parking and storage of oversized vehicles. "About 25 citizens attended the meeting," said City Administrator David Stall. "The room was largely filled with people who were opposed to overreaching regulations. The city council presented plaques to Mike Fisco as Citizen of the Year and Robin Eldridge as Employee of the Year. Photo The city council voted unanimously to approve a donation of crushed granite from Bay Area Fencing, Decking and Lawn Service to be used for 719 feet of trail in Heron Park. The city council voted unanimously to approve the final plat combining Lots 6, 7 and 8 of Block 13 into a single parcel by owner LaVelle Hamilton, as had been approved by the Planning Commission.
